三维实体退化虚拟层合梁单元在梁极限承载力分析中的应用

摘    要:提出采用三维实体退化虚拟层合梁单元计算梁极限承载力的方法.考虑结构的几何非线性和材料非线性,利用该单元编制了极限承载力计算程序,并将其应用于梁极限承载力的分析.计算实例表明,该单元收敛快,稳定性好,在单元数较少的情况下,具有较高的精度.由于能克服块体单元或梁段单元法的缺陷,该计算方法具有更强的通用性.
